I've been dreaming of doing a session like this for a while now, so it has been pretty incredible to see it come to life like this. Marissa Prosper is a first generation Dalhousie Law student, paving the way for future generations and ready to inspire real change in her community. She is seen here showcasing her own hand-made traditional Mi'kmaq jewelry and light pink ribbon skirt. The scenery of the Tangled Garden in Grand-Pré pay beautiful homage to her Indigenous heritage and incredible connection with nature. A huge thank you to Jess from Wedding Whisperer for being my creative second set of eyes for this one, and making sure my vision really came to life.


"I take great pride in who I am and have always been taught to do so. My culture is more than my identity- it is my strength." - Marissa Prosper
